This week's summary
SoFi shares slip 4.7% this week, but the price action tells a fuller story: a clean double bottom in the 16 area, with a 26% intermediate rebound. The latest bar is more cautious, though - sellers dominated to an extreme and buyer dominance is clearly collapsing. The buy signal, which fired three weeks ago, holds: confirmation reads positive and our model suggests keeping the position unchanged. This SoFi technical analysis has it ranking 15th among 124 open US buy signals.
